What to Know About Peptides Earlier than Considering a Buy

Peptides have grow to be a widely mentioned topic in health, fitness, skincare, and research communities. Whether persons are exploring them for performance goals, wellness interests, or scientific curiosity, peptides often seem in on-line searches and product listings with bold claims and technical language. Before considering a purchase order, it is necessary to understand what peptides are, how they’re commonly marketed, and what factors ought to guide a careful decision.

Peptides are quick chains of amino acids, which are the building blocks of proteins. Within the body, peptides play many roles and might act as signaling molecules that influence completely different biological processes. Because of this, they’re typically studied in research settings and are also utilized in some consumer products, especially in skincare. Nonetheless, not all peptides are the same, and their purpose, quality, and intended use can range significantly.

One of the first things to know’s that peptides are sometimes marketed in very completely different categories. Some are sold for beauty use, reminiscent of anti-aging lotions and serums that embrace peptide ingredients. Others could also be described as research compounds, while some are discussed in connection with fitness or body composition goals. This creates confusion for buyers, especially when product pages use obscure language or make broad promises. Understanding the class of a peptide product is essential earlier than making any decision.

One other key point is that product quality matters greatly. Because peptides will be sensitive compounds, buyers should pay attention to manufacturing standards, storage recommendations, and purity claims. A reliable seller ought to provide clear product information, including ingredient particulars, batch information when applicable, and transparent labeling. If a product description seems incomplete, exaggerated, or troublesome to verify, that ought to be treated as a warning sign. Quality concerns are particularly important in a market the place some sellers might prioritize marketing over accuracy.

It is usually essential to be cautious about unrealistic claims. Some peptide listings promise dramatic improvements in muscle development, recovery, fat loss, skin look, or general wellness. These claims might sound interesting, but not every product is supported by sturdy evidence, and marketing language can simply overstate expected outcomes. A careful buyer should look at claims with a critical mindset and keep away from assuming that on-line popularity is the same as proven effectiveness.

Legal standing and intended use are additionally price reviewing. Depending on the product and the area, some peptides may be regulated differently from commonplace consumer goods. A purchaser should understand whether or not the product is supposed for beauty use, laboratory research, or another specific purpose. It is by no means sensible to rely only on advertising language. Reading labels carefully and understanding how a product is classified might help prevent confusion and reduce the risk of buying something inappropriate for the intended use.

Price is another factor that deserves attention. Peptide products can fluctuate widely in cost, and a higher price doesn’t always assure better quality. On the same time, extraordinarily low costs might increase concerns about sourcing, purity, or authenticity. Comparing sellers, checking for constant product information, and reviewing whether or not the brand presents itself professionally can all assist when evaluating value. Smart buyers tend to give attention to transparency and credibility fairly than worth alone.

Storage and handling are sometimes overlooked but may be important. Some peptide products might require specific storage conditions to maintain stability. If a seller provides no information about storage, shelf life, or handling, that will counsel a lack of quality control. Buyers ought to make sure they understand how the product must be kept and whether it will arrive in appropriate condition.

Customer reviews can provide additional perception, but they need to be read carefully. Reviews may be useful once they discuss packaging, service quality, and total buyer experience. However, dramatic personal claims shouldn’t automatically be treated as proof of performance. Reviews are best used as one part of a broader analysis, not because the only reason to trust a product.

In the end, anybody thinking about peptides ought to take time to understand the product earlier than making a purchase. Learning the basics, checking the intended category, questioning sturdy marketing claims, and evaluating seller transparency may help reduce risk. Peptides might sound promising, however an informed approach is always better than an impulsive one. When buyers deal with accuracy, quality, and clarity, they’re in a much stronger position to make a considerate decision.
